688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

汇编语言

汇编语言标识符的命名规则

2024-01-17 13:54:55

汇编语言标识符的命名规则汇编语言是一种底层的计算机语言,用于编写和控制计算机硬件的指令集。在汇编语言中,标识符(Identifier)是用来标识变量、常量、过程和其他元素的命名符号。正确的标识符命名规则是编写有效且易于理解的汇编程序的关键。一、命名规则总览在编写汇编语言程序时,需要遵守以下命名规则:1. 字母和数字组成:标识符只能包含字母(A-Z,a-z)和数字(0-9),且首字符必须是字母。2....

学完c语言学汇编

2024-01-17 13:46:03

学完c语言学汇编学习完C语言后,学习汇编语言是一个很好的选择,因为汇编语言与C语言有很多相似之处,可以帮助你更好地理解计算机底层的工作原理。c语言中文网汇编语言学习汇编语言可以让你更好地理解计算机如何执行程序,包括CPU指令集、内存管理、栈和堆等概念。此外,汇编语言还可以帮助你更好地优化C语言代码,提高程序的执行效率和性能。在学习汇编语言之前,你需要了解一些基础知识,例如计算机架构、操作系统和编译...

试验一-2学时keil环境下汇编语言与c语言程序设计

2024-01-17 13:43:59

实验一汇编语言、C语言程序设计与调试一、实验目标1.学习及掌握MCS-51汇编源程序的书写格式和汇编语言、C语言、混合编程的语法规则;2.学习及掌握Keil C51的软件的基本操作;3.掌握在Keil C51开发平台上建立、汇编、连接、调试及运行汇编程序的方法和步骤;4.以示例汇编语言源程序为蓝本,掌握在Keil C51平台上开发单片机应用程序的一般步骤,记录操作过程和结果;5.学习Keil C5...

用C语言和ARM汇编语言设置SDRAM的惯用方法

2024-01-17 13:42:13

用C语言和ARM汇编语言设置SDRAM的惯用方法用C语言设置SDRAM的惯用方法/* SDRAM regisers */ #defineMEM_CTL_BASE0x48000000// BWSCON的地址 #defineSDRAM_BASE0x30000000// SDRAM的起始地址 /* SDRAM 13个寄存器的值*/ /*定义了一个数组,把13个寄存器的设置值存到一个数组里面*/ unsi...

C语言与汇编语言在单片机教学中的融合应用

2024-01-17 13:39:03

C语言与汇编语言在单片机教学中的融合应用作者:程娅荔 王巧玲来源:《科技视界》2012年第14期c语言中文网汇编语言        【摘 要】本文讲述了在《单片机原理及应用》课程教学的特点,根据C语言和汇编语言各自的优点,提出了在单片机教学中融合应用C语言与汇编语言的教学方法。        【关键词】C语言;汇编语言...

c语言utf8字符转换,C语言示例-中文转换成UTF-8编码

2024-01-17 13:35:36

c语⾔utf8字符转换,C语⾔⽰例-中⽂转换成UTF-8编码/** 中⽂字符串转UTF-8与GBK码⽰例*/public static void tttt() throws Exception {String old = “⼿机银⾏”;//中⽂转换成UTF-8编码(16进制字符串)StringBuffer utf8Str = new StringBuffer();byte[] utf8Decode...

15.6.1 汇编语言字模转换为C语言字模_单片机C语言程序设计_[共2页...

2024-01-17 13:35:25

220 模输出框”中显示,同时在D盘中会建立一个XHZK16.TXT文件(假定提取的字模是16×16点阵),将文件打开,将字模最后一个“,”去掉,拷贝到一个数组中就可以在程序中使用了。15.6 汇编语言字模与C语言字模互相转换通过上面的通用字膜提取程序可以提取汇编语言形式的字膜或C语言形式的字膜,如果手头上有汇编语言形式的字膜,想用C语言形式表示,或者想把C语言形式字膜转换为汇编语言形式的字膜,利...

单片机程序编程

2024-01-17 13:35:00

单片机程序编程单片机程序编程是指在单片机芯片上编写程序,实现指定功能的过程。随着科技的发展,单片机程序编程在电子设备、嵌入式系统和物联网等领域得到了广泛应用。本文将介绍单片机程序编程的基本概念、常用编程语言和编程实践经验。一、基本概念1. 单片机概述单片机是一种集成电路芯片,它集中了微处理器、存储器、输入输出端口和定时器等功能。它具有体积小、功耗低、处理速度快等特点,被广泛应用于各种电子设备。2....

汇编语言在网络方面的应用

2024-01-17 13:34:35

          汇编语言在网络方面的应用网络工程一班  0925113037  唐金(2011.05.30)一 汇编语言介绍汇编语言(AssemblyLanguage)是面向机器的程序设计语言。在汇编语合中,用助记符(Memoni)代替操作码,用地址符号c语言中文网汇编语言(Symbol)或标号(Label)代替地址码。这...

C语言和汇编语言参数的传递

2024-01-17 13:29:44

C语言和汇编语言参数的传递在C语言中,函数参数的传递有两种方式:值传递和引用传递。在值传递中,函数将参数的实际值复制到形式参数中,这意味着在函数内对参数的任何更改都不会影响到原始变量。而在引用传递中,函数通过传递变量的地址来传递参数,这允许函数直接操作原始变量,因此在函数内对参数的任何更改都会影响到原始变量。C语言中,参数的传递方式是根据函数声明时参数类型的决定的。例如,如果参数是基本数据类型(如...

C语言与汇编语言混合编程 32位嵌入式

2024-01-17 13:29:17

实验二  C语言与汇编语言混合编程一、 实验目的1.掌握ARM嵌入式C语言编程基本方法。2.  掌握嵌入式汇编(Inline Assembly)编程规则和方法。3.掌握汇编语言程序和C语言程序之间相互调用规则和编程方法。二、实验步骤1.  创建工作空间并且添加工程。2.编写程序并且利用软件仿真查看结果。三、实验内容1. 利用汇编语言编写初始化程序,实现管理模式下堆栈指...

单片机编程入门学习C语言和汇编语言

2024-01-17 13:28:11

单片机编程入门学习C语言和汇编语言随着科技的发展,单片机已经成为嵌入式系统中不可或缺的部分。单片机是一种集成电路芯片,具有控制和处理功能,广泛应用于各个领域。要想进行单片机编程,学习C语言和汇编语言是必不可少的。本文将介绍单片机编程入门所需的C语言和汇编语言知识,帮助读者快速掌握单片机编程技能。一、C语言入门C语言是一种高级程序设计语言,特点是语法简洁、灵活、易学易用。它广泛应用于软件开发和嵌入式...

ARM中ADS环境下C语言和汇编语言混合编程及示例)

2024-01-17 13:27:48

ARM中ADS环境下C语言和汇编语言混合编程及示例(转)lpc2000系列 2009-11-18 09:50:51 阅读230 评论0 字号:大中小 稍大规模的嵌入式程序设计中,大部分的代码都是用C来编写的,主要是因为C语言具有较强的结构性,便于人的理解,并且具有大量的库支持。但对于一写硬件上的操作,很多地方还是要用到汇编语言,例如硬件系统的初始化中的CPU 状态的设定,中断的使能,主频的设定,R...

机器语言汇编语言c语言之间的关系

2024-01-17 13:26:14

机器语言汇编语言c语言之间的关系机器语言、汇编语言和C语言是计算机领域中的三种不同级别的编程语言。它们之间存在着紧密的联系和层次关系。首先,我们来了解一下机器语言。机器语言是计算机能够直接理解和执行的语言,它由一系列二进制代码组成,每个指令对应着一种计算机操作。机器语言是计算机硬件的最底层表示形式,它通常与特定的硬件架构密切相关。由于机器语言较为晦涩难懂,编写和调试相对繁琐,因此很少有程序员直接使...

c语言和汇编的对应关系

2024-01-17 13:25:46

c语言和汇编的对应关系C语言和汇编的对应关系C语言和汇编语言是计算机编程中常用的两种语言,它们之间有着密切的关系。C语言是一种高级编程语言,而汇编语言是一种低级编程语言。本文将从不同层次、不同特点和应用等方面来探讨C语言和汇编的对应关系。1. 层次对应关系C语言是一种高级语言,它的语法结构更加接近自然语言,具有更高的抽象层次。而汇编语言则是一种低级语言,它的语法结构更加接近机器语言,需要直接操作底...

C语言内嵌汇编

2024-01-17 13:25:22

C语言内嵌汇编在C语言中如何使用汇编语言呢?这个问题在不同的编译器中,具体实现方法是不同的。不过在实现大方上也不过就是有两种,而且各种编译器的实现方法也是大同小异。一种是在C语言中嵌入汇编语言代码,另一种是让C语言从外部调用汇编。下面我们就以Borland 格式为例来说一说具体用法。但是,GCC与Microsoft的实现方法的与Borland只在格式上有点区别。当然,GCC的嵌入汇编是AT&...

C语言和汇编语言混合编程理工

2024-01-17 13:25:11

第6章 C语言和汇编语言混合编程6.1  C语言和汇编语言混合编程中参数传递和寄存器使用 在很多DSP应用中使用C语言和汇编语言进行混合编程。C语言具有可读性高、便于维护和可移植性好等优点,然而汇编语言具有实时运行效率高和代码效率高的优点。使用汇编语言可以更充分地利用DSP的硬件资源,例如乘累加单元、单指令重复、块重复和块移动等等。某些程序使用汇编语言编写实时运行效率是C语言的几十倍或更...

c语言汇编程序

2024-01-17 13:22:49

以下是一个简单的C语言程序,它使用汇编语言实现了一个计算两个整数相加的函数:```c#include <stdio.h>int add(int a, int b) {    int sum;    __asm__("addl %%ebx, %%eax;"c语言中文网汇编语言          &n...

MSP430单片机C语言和汇编语言混合编程刍议

2024-01-17 13:16:51

MSP430单片机C语言和汇编语言混合编程刍议李悝(山东工艺美术学院,山东济南250300)摘要:主要结合C语言与汇编语言进行计算机程序编写设计中各自的特征优势,从C语言与汇编语言混合编程方法,以及混合语言进行MSP430单片机编程设计的具体过程等方面,进行MSP430单片机C语言与汇编语言混合编程的分析论述。关键词:MSP430单片机;C语言;汇编语言;编程设计;软件开发;分析中图分类号:TG8...

汇编语言与C语言的混合程序设计技术

2024-01-17 13:15:34

2017年第11期信息与电脑China Computer&Communication算法语言汇编语言与C 语言的混合程序设计技术罗 珈(天津农学院,天津 300384)摘 要:汇编语言和C 语言在软件的开发中都具有很重要的作用,它们各有各的特点,首先,汇编语言是一种面向机器的语言,它有着占用存储空间小、运行速度快并且可以直接控制硬件特点,在数值混合运算和处理中表现突出,但是,它在编写和调试...

汇编语言与c语言编程在嵌入式开发中的作用

2024-01-17 13:14:31

汇编语言与c语言编程在嵌入式开发中的作用    随着嵌入式开发的不断发展,汇编语言和C语言编程显得越来越重要。汇编语言是一种低级编程语言,它可以将计算机指令表示为更容易理解的代码,使程序员能够更容易地直接控制计算机的操作。C语言编程则是一种面向对象的高级编程语言,它可以使软件开发以及复杂任务的分解更加容易。两者合在一起,可以产生无与伦比的强大,从而使嵌入式开发得以实现。&nbs...

单片机编程入门从C语言到汇编语言

2024-01-17 13:14:07

单片机编程入门从C语言到汇编语言随着技术的不断发展,单片机已经广泛应用于各个领域,成为许多电子产品的核心。单片机编程是掌握单片机技术的重要一环,其中从C语言到汇编语言的转换是学习单片机编程的必经之路。本文将就这个主题展开讨论,介绍单片机编程入门的基本知识和技巧。一、C语言基础知识C语言是编写单片机程序的常用语言,具有易学易用的特点。在开始学习单片机编程之前,有必要掌握C语言的基本语法和概念。1.数...

单片机编程:C语言和汇编语言的比较

2024-01-17 13:11:31

单片机编程:C语言和汇编语言的比较c语言中文网汇编语言随着计算机技术的不断发展,单片机的应用范围也越来越广泛。而在单片机的编程语言中,C语言和汇编语言是两种最为常见的语言。那么,C语言和汇编语言之间究竟有何异同呢?本文将对这两种语言进行比较分析。一、C语言和汇编语言的定义C语言是一种高级语言,属于结构化语言。它是由美国贝尔实验室的Dennis Ritchie在20世纪70年代初期发明的。C语言具有...

汇编语言的意思

2024-01-16 01:17:10

汇编语言的意思汇编语言是计算机科学中最原始和最底层的计算机编程语言。它成为计算机科学的基石,因为它直接交流人类意志和机器的需求。汇编语言跳转指令汇编语言是一种低级编程语言,在其中,程序向量与机器可读的二进制代码之间的转换交由编译器完成。编译器可根据汇编转换为针对特定服务器的指令,从而使服务器能够处理用户任务。汇编语言是计算机直接支持的一种语言,它使用简单而直观的指令表述,比如“搬运”指令将数据从内...

32位汇编语言程序设计第二版教学设计

2024-01-16 01:14:47

32位汇编语言程序设计第二版教学设计一、教学目标本教学设计旨在通过对32位汇编语言程序设计的学习,达到以下教学目标:1.了解32位汇编语言的基本语法和编程方法;2.掌握32位汇编语言程序设计的基本流程和方法;3.熟练运用32位汇编语言编写简单的程序。二、教学内容1. 介绍32位汇编语言的基本概念和编程环境•32位汇编语言的概念和特点;•32位汇编语言编程环境的搭建方法;•汇编器的作用及其使用方法。...

gun汇编定义函数

2024-01-16 01:14:36

gun汇编定义函数(原创实用版)1.汇编语言简介  2.gun 汇编器的定义  3.函数的定义与调用  4.示例:编写一个简单的 gun 汇编函数汇编语言跳转指令正文1.汇编语言简介汇编语言是一种低级编程语言,它使用助记符来表示计算机的机器指令。每个汇编语言指令对应于计算机中的一条机器指令。汇编语言的优点是它能直接操作硬件,运行速度较快,适用于编写系统级软件和底层驱动...

汇编语言术语

2024-01-16 01:13:50

汇编语言术语汇编语言(Assembly Language)是一种低级程序设计语言,它使用与特定计算机体系结构密切相关的符号指令来编写程序。以下是一些汇编语言的术语:1. 指令(Instruction):汇编程序的基本执行单位,用于执行特定的操作,如加法、乘法等。2. 操作码(Opcode):指令中用来表示操作类型的字段,例如ADD表示加法。3. 寄存器(Register):用于存储临时数据和操作结...

汇编语言程序设计示例

2024-01-16 01:13:25

汇编语言程序设计示例汇编语言是一种底层的计算机指令语言,常用于编写操作系统、嵌入式系统以及对计算机硬件进行精细控制的程序。本文将为您提供一些汇编语言程序设计的示例,帮助您更好地理解和应用汇编语言。示例一:计算两个整数的和```section .data    num1 db 5        ; 定义第一个整数为5  &nbs...

汇编语言的语句格式

2024-01-16 01:12:36

汇编语言的语句格式汇编语言是一种低级编程语言,与机器语言直接对应,用于编写底层程序。在汇编语言中,语句格式十分重要,它决定了指令的执行方式和结果的准确性。以下是汇编语言中常见的语句格式:1. 指令语句格式  指令语句是汇编代码中最常见的语句类型,用于执行特定的操作。一般而言,指令语句由操作码(op code)和操作数(operand)两部分组成。  例如,MOV指令是将数据...

int 21h汇编语言

2024-01-16 01:12:12

int 21h汇编语言(最新版)1.汇编语言简介  2.21h 的含义  3.int 21h 的功能  4.使用 int 21h 的实例  5.int 21h 的优缺点正文一、汇编语言简介汇编语言是一种低级的编程语言,它使用计算机处理器能够理解的指令。与高级语言相比,汇编语言更加接近计算机硬件,因此运行速度更快。但由于汇编语言的语法较为复杂,编写难度较高。二...

最新文章